fre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于stc89c52單片機(jī)溫度報(bào)警器畢業(yè)論文-全文預(yù)覽

2025-04-01 06:09 上一頁面

下一頁面
  

【正文】 TSR1: DJNZ R0,TSR1 SETB DQ MOV R0,25H TSR2: DJNZ R0,TSR2 JNB DQ,TSR3 LJMP TSR4 TSR3: SETB FLAG1 LJMP TSR5 TSR4 : CLR FLAG1 LJMP TSR7 TSR5: MOV R0,06BH TSR6: DJNZ R0,TSR6 TSR7: SETB DQ RET 基于 STC89C52 單片機(jī)溫度報(bào)警器 29 液晶顯示程序 DISPLAY1:LCALL LCD_CS MOV R0,11 MOV 50H,0 MOV R1,08H A1: MOV A, R1 MOV P0,A ACALL ENABLE MOV DPTR,TABLE1 MOV A ,50H MOVC A ,A +DPTR LCALL WRITE_E INC 50H INC R1 DJNZ R0,A1 RET DISPLAY2; LCALL LCD_CS MOV P0,0C1H CALL ENABLE LCALL WRITE1 RET WRITE1:MOV R1,4 基于 STC89C52 單片機(jī)溫度報(bào)警器 30 MOV R0,37H MOV DPTR,TABLE2 B1: MOV A,R0 MOVC A,A+DPTR CALL WRITE_E INC R0 DJNZ RI,B1 RET DISPLAY3:LCALL LCD_CS MOV R0,16 MOV 50H,0 MOV RI,80H C1: MOV A,R1 MOV P0,A ACALL ENABLE MOV DPTR ,TABLE3 MOV A ,50H MOVC A,A+DPTR LCALL WRITE_E INC 50H INC R1 DJNZ R0,C1 基于 STC89C52 單片機(jī)溫度報(bào)警器 31 RET ENABLE :CLR RS CLR RW CLR E ACALL DELAY3 SETB E RET WRITE_E:CALL DELAY3 SETB RS CLR RW SETB E MOV P0,A CLR E RET LCD_CS : MOV P0,01H ACALL ENABLE MOV P0,38H ACALL ENABLE MOV P0,0CH ACALL ENABLE MOV P0,06H ACALL ENABLE 基于 STC89C52 單片機(jī)溫度報(bào)警器 32 DELAY3:MOV R7 ,20 D1:MOV R6,250 D2:DJNZ R6,D2 DJNZ R7,D1 RET TABLE1:DB 39。 圖 LCD 1602 連接電路圖 第 16 腳:背光源負(fù)極。當(dāng) RS 和 R/W 共同為低電平時(shí)可以寫入指 令或者顯示地址,當(dāng)RS為低電平 R/W為高電平時(shí)可以讀忙信號(hào),當(dāng) RS 為高電平 R/W 為低電平時(shí)可以寫入數(shù)據(jù)。 第 2 腳: VDD 接 5V 正電源。 DS18B20 的管腳排列、各種封裝形式如圖 所示。 圖 LCD1602 內(nèi)部顯示地址 (二)、電路的設(shè)計(jì) 最小系統(tǒng)電路設(shè)計(jì) 本系統(tǒng)使用兒的基于單片機(jī)的溫度計(jì)的設(shè)計(jì)所以首先設(shè)計(jì)單片機(jī)的最小系統(tǒng),所謂最小系統(tǒng)是一個(gè)真正可用的單片機(jī)的最小配置系統(tǒng)。 指令 8: DDRAM 地址設(shè)置。 C:控制 光標(biāo)的開與關(guān),高電平表示有光標(biāo),低電平表示無光標(biāo) B:控制光標(biāo)是否閃爍,高電平閃爍,低電平不閃爍。 LCD1602 顯示原理 ( 1) LCD1602 的控制原理: 1602 液晶模塊內(nèi)部的控制器共有 11 條控制指令,如下表所示 表 LCD1602 控制指令 序號(hào) 指令 RS R/W D7 D6 D5 D4 D3 D2 D1 D0 1 清顯示 0 0 0 0 0 0 0 0 0 1 2 光標(biāo)返回 0 0 0 0 0 0 0 0 1 * 3 置輸入模式 0 0 0 0 0 0 0 1 I/D S 4 顯示開 /關(guān)控制 0 0 0 0 0 0 1 D C B 5 光標(biāo)或字符移位 0 0 0 0 0 1 S/C R/L * * 6 置功能 0 0 0 0 1 DL N F * * 7 置字符發(fā)生存貯器地址 0 0 0 1 字符發(fā)生存貯器地址 8 置數(shù)據(jù)存貯器地址 0 0 1 顯示數(shù)據(jù)存貯器地址 9 讀忙標(biāo)志或地址 0 1 BF 計(jì)數(shù)器地址 10 寫數(shù)到 CGRAM 或DDRAM) 1 0 要寫的數(shù) 據(jù)內(nèi)容 11 從 CGRAM 或 DDRAM讀數(shù) 1 1 讀出的數(shù)據(jù)內(nèi)容 基于 STC89C52 單片機(jī)溫度報(bào)警器 17 LCD1602 液晶模塊的讀寫操作,屏幕和光標(biāo)的操作都是通過指令編程來實(shí)現(xiàn)的。 在正常測(cè)溫情況下, DS18B20 的測(cè)溫分辨力為 ℃,可采用下述方法獲得高分辨率的溫度測(cè)量結(jié)果:首先用 DS18B20 提供的讀暫存器指令 (BEH)讀出以 ℃為分辨率的溫度測(cè)量結(jié)果,然后切去測(cè)量結(jié)果中的最低有效位 (LSB),得到所測(cè)實(shí)際溫度的整數(shù)部 分 Tz,然后再用 BEH 指令取計(jì)數(shù)器 1 的計(jì)數(shù)剩余值 Cs 和每度計(jì)數(shù)值 CD。格式中, S 表示位。 基于 STC89C52 單片機(jī)溫度報(bào)警器 12 表 溫度值分辨率配置表 R1 R0 分辨率 最大轉(zhuǎn)換時(shí)間(ms) 0 0 9 位 (tconv/8) 0 1 10 位 (tconv /4) 1 0 11 位 375ms(tconv /2) 1 1 12 位 750ms(tconv) 當(dāng) DS18B20 接收到溫度轉(zhuǎn)換命令后,開始啟動(dòng)轉(zhuǎn)換。 圖 高速暫存 RAM 結(jié)構(gòu)圖 其中,前 2 個(gè)字節(jié)包含測(cè)得的溫度信息,第 3 和第 4 字節(jié) TH 和 TL 的拷貝,是易失的,每次上電復(fù)位時(shí)被刷新。 ▲ 64 位光刻 ROM,內(nèi)置產(chǎn)品序列號(hào),方便多機(jī)掛接。 C ~+125176。 ▲ 最高 12 位分辨率,精度可達(dá)土 攝氏度。 STC89C52 單片機(jī)為 40 引腳雙列直插芯片 ,有四個(gè) I/O 口 P0、 P P P3,每一條 I/O 線都能獨(dú)立地作輸出或輸入。 方案 二 我們可以采用技術(shù)成熟、操作簡(jiǎn)單、精確度高的溫度傳感器,在此,可以選用數(shù)字溫度傳感器 DS18B20,根據(jù)它的特點(diǎn)和測(cè)溫原理,很容易就能直接讀取被測(cè)溫度值并進(jìn)行轉(zhuǎn)換,這樣就可以滿足設(shè)計(jì)要求。 基于 STC89C52 單片機(jī)溫度報(bào)警器 7 目前使用的 MCS51 系列單片機(jī)及其兼容產(chǎn)品通常分成以下幾類:基本型、增強(qiáng)型、低功耗型、專用型、超 8 位型、片內(nèi)閃爍存儲(chǔ)器型。 我們?cè)O(shè)計(jì)了這種造價(jià)低廉、使用方便且測(cè)量準(zhǔn)確的溫濕度測(cè)量?jī)x。但傳統(tǒng)的方法是用與濕度表、毛發(fā)濕度表、雙金屬式測(cè)量計(jì)和濕度試紙等測(cè)試器材,通過人工進(jìn)行檢測(cè),對(duì)不符合溫度和濕度要求的庫房進(jìn)行通風(fēng)、去濕和降溫等工作。 、圖表要求: 1)文字通順,語言流暢,書寫字跡工整,打印字體及大小符合要求,無錯(cuò)別字,不準(zhǔn)請(qǐng)他人代寫 2)工程設(shè)計(jì)類題目的圖紙,要求部 分用尺規(guī)繪制,部分用計(jì)算機(jī)繪制,所有圖紙應(yīng)符合國家技術(shù)標(biāo)準(zhǔn)規(guī)范。學(xué)??梢怨颊撐模ㄔO(shè)計(jì))的全部或部分內(nèi)容。據(jù)我所知, 除文中已經(jīng)注明引用的內(nèi)容外,本論文(設(shè)計(jì))不包含其他個(gè)人已經(jīng)發(fā)表或撰寫過的研究成果。 基于 STC89C52 單片機(jī)溫度報(bào)警器 2 Abstract Temperature detection and control of industrial production process, one of the more typical applications, with sensors in production and life is more widely used, using a new singlebus digital temperature sensor to achieve the test and control the temperature more rapidly development, this paper is designed based on STC89C52 temperature detection and alarm systems. The system will be more than a singlebus temperature sensor DS18B20 and connected to a port on the controller, the temperature sensors on each loop collection, the temperature will be collected to pare with the set value, when the temperature exceeds the upper limit set , Through the buzzer alarm. The system design and layout simple and pact structure, small size, light weight, antijamming capability, costeffective to expand convenience, in large warehouses, factories, construction and other areas of intelligent multipoint temperature measurement in a wide range of applications prospects. Key words: digital temperature sensor。基于 STC89C52 單片機(jī)溫度報(bào)警器 摘 要 溫度的檢測(cè)與控制是工業(yè)生產(chǎn)過程中比較典型的應(yīng)用之一,隨著傳感器在生產(chǎn)和生活中的更
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1